Xplain AI
Imparare è facile
Descrizione
Xplain AI consente conversazioni in tempo reale con documenti, file multimediali e siti web. Quando gli utenti caricano i documenti, una pipeline di estrazione converte il testo in rappresentazioni vettoriali utilizzando il modello embedding-001. Questi vettori, insieme ai batch di testo e agli URL dei file, vengono archiviati in modo efficiente, sfruttando il batching di Firebase per i documenti di grandi dimensioni. Dopo la vettorizzazione, gli utenti vengono indirizzati a una pagina di chat per interagire con il documento. I messaggi degli utenti vengono incorporati e abbinati tramite una ricerca di somiglianza di coseni in Firestore, recuperando il testo più simile per le risposte generate da Gemini.
Per i file multimediali, una pipeline di preelaborazione li analizza e li converte in testo, che viene poi incorporato. Questa pipeline utilizza l'API File Manager e Gemini per un'analisi approfondita. Nella pagina della chat, un pulsante "sessione di studio" trasforma i messaggi della chat in formato di domande e risposte, consentendo agli utenti di convertire i messaggi iniziali della chat in coppie di domande e risposte per un apprendimento più efficace. Un editor online facilita la modifica e il download dei messaggi della chat, un vantaggio per i ricercatori.
L'integrazione di Gemini è fondamentale per Xplain AI, in quanto consente l'embedding, le ricerche di somiglianza, l'analisi dei file multimediali e la generazione di domande e risposte, garantendo risposte immediate e accurate. Questa integrazione garantisce agli utenti l'accesso in tempo reale alle informazioni più pertinenti dei loro documenti, migliorando le loro esperienze di ricerca e apprendimento.
Realizzato con
- Firebase
Team
Di
Team Salone
Da
Sierra Leone